Will Hydrocodone Cause Problems In Pregnancy?

i just found out I m pregnant about a week and half ago. I am currently on a lot of different medications due to my lupus and RA. I ve stopped all my medicateons except my pain meds which is Hydrocodone. i take a 10/325 every 4 to 6 hours. is it ok to still take it while being pregnant? am i harming my baby?

Any drug taken during pregnancy could cause a risk for the developing fetus.
Hydrocodone is in a group of drugs called narcotic pain relievers.
The drug under FDA pregnancy category is 'C', which means the drug should only be given during pregnancy when benefit outweighs risk.
Kindly consult your doctor for a change of medication accordingly as it carries a certain amount of risk when used in pregnancy.
